The first feature that stands out to me is the 6.05 oz, 500-denier Cordura nylon shell. This material is not only durable but also resistant to abrasions, ensuring that the coverall can withstand the rigors of daily wear and tear. Additionally, the 150g 3M Thinsulate insulation provides exceptional warmth without adding unnecessary bulk. This is particularly important for those of us who need to maintain mobility while staying warm. I can imagine wearing this coverall during long winter shifts without feeling restricted or weighed down.
Another impressive aspect is the Wind Fighter technology, which effectively tames the wind. I’ve experienced my fair share of windy days, and having a coverall that can mitigate the chill makes all the difference in comfort levels. Coupled with the Rain Defender durable water repellent (DWR) feature, this coverall offers a comprehensive solution for wet and windy weather, ensuring that I stay dry no matter the conditions.
When it comes to functionality, the design of the coverall shines through. The triple-stitched main seams enhance durability, which is vital for a work garment. I appreciate the two-way center front zipper that allows for easy on-and-off access, especially when I’m in a hurry or need to shed a layer quickly. The rib-knit storm cuffs and under-collar hood snaps provide added protection against the elements, ensuring that I can adjust my fit according to the weather conditions.
The double-layer knees with openings for adding knee pads is another feature I find particularly valuable. For individuals who spend a lot of time kneeling, this thoughtful addition allows for customization and comfort while also making it easy to clean out debris. The ankle-to-thigh leg zippers with storm flaps and snap closures enhance usability, making it simple to put on or take off the coverall without removing my boots. This is especially useful when transitioning from outdoor work to indoor tasks.
Lastly, the 3M reflective Carhartt patch on the secure chest pocket adds an element of safety, ensuring that I remain visible in low-light conditions. The elastic back waist provides an additional comfort fit, preventing any restrictions during movement. Material Matters
The material of the coveralls plays a crucial role in insulation and durability. I found that materials like polyester and nylon offer excellent insulation while being lightweight. Additionally, I recommend considering water-resistant or waterproof materials if you expect to be in wet conditions.
Insulation Types
There are various insulation types available, and I learned that synthetic insulation is often the best choice for wet conditions, while down insulation offers superior warmth but may not perform well when wet. Understanding these differences helped me prioritize what I needed based on my activities and weather conditions.
Fit and Comfort
Finding the right fit is essential for both comfort and mobility. I discovered that coveralls should allow for layering underneath without feeling restrictive. I suggest trying on different sizes and styles to ensure that you can move freely, especially if you plan to wear them for extended periods.
Features to Look For
When I browsed through options, I noted several features that enhanced functionality. Pockets are vital for storage, especially if I need to carry tools or personal items. Additionally, I found that reinforced knees and elbows are important for durability, particularly in rugged work environments.
Weather Resistance
As I delved deeper, I realized that some coveralls come with windproof and waterproof features. If I plan to work or spend time outside in harsh weather, these features are non-negotiable. A good coverall should protect me from the elements while allowing me to stay warm.
Ease of Use
I appreciated features that make putting on and taking off the coveralls easier. Zippers, snaps, and adjustable cuffs are essential for convenience. I also looked for options with easy-access designs, especially if I need to layer quickly or change in a hurry.
Care and Maintenance
Maintenance is a factor I often overlook, but I learned that some materials require special care. I recommend checking the care instructions before purchasing. Some coveralls are machine washable, while others may need to be hand washed or dry cleaned.
Price Range
Insulated coveralls can vary significantly in price. I discovered that while it’s tempting to go for the cheaper options, investing in a quality pair can save me money in the long run. I suggest determining my budget and balancing it with the features I truly need.
